Vis is one of the furthest islands of the Adriatic Sea, known as the Key of the Adriatic concerning its excellent geographic position. When staying on Vis, you have a chance to spot a vast number of bird species. Together with the Svetac Island, which we also visit, Vis is the most northern nesting place of the beautiful and endangered Eleonor’s Falcon (Falco Eleonorae). The Cory’s Shearwater (Calonectris diomedea) and Yelkouan Shearwater (Puffi nus Yelkouan) are also part of a rich avifauna that you are able to see and capture through the lens of your camera. Apart from enjoying the company of these magnifi cent birds, a traditional life of fi shermen in the village of Komiža and Mediterranean cuisine, makes your stay on this magical island even more memorable.
